Abstract

Raw data is uploaded to a workspace, and an asset is determined from the raw data. The asset from the raw data is compared with an existing asset in the workspace to determine if the asset from the raw data already exists in the workspace. The comparing includes comparing a first distinguished name of the asset from the raw data with a second distinguished name of the existing asset to determine if the first and second distinguished names are the same.
